Excerpt from Restitution, Vol. 3 of 3 It was late before all these matters were settled, and not only Hoplands but the village was astir till near midnight. Police patrolled the Park and guarded the ruined house, while inquisitive strangers came from afar to look on, for where the hive Of excitement is thither swarm the wasps and drones. The few servants who were left at the Park, after the summary notice given by the upper ones, were quartered in the village or at the rectory, and by degrees peace fell on troubled Roselands. Excerpt from Redeemed in Blood, Vol. 1 of 3 A scene of extreme beauty, yet withal a very lonely one! So thought Oswald St. Maur as, sketch-book in hand, he settled himself in the shade of an over hanging rock, and made preparations for committing it to paper. He was a young man struggling towards fame, an artist Who depended on his pencil and brush for a livelihood, and at the time our story Opens, engaged on a walking and sketch ing tour through the western highlands of Scotland. Excerpt from The Emancipated, Vol. 1 of 3: A Novel It is very kind of you to be so active in attending to the things which you know I have at heart. You say I shall find everything as I could wish it on my return, but you cannot think what a stranger to Bartles I already feel. It will soon be six months since I lived my real life there; during my illness I might as well have been absent, then came those weeks in the Isle of Wight, and now this exile. I feel it as exile, bitterly. To be sure Naples is beau tiful, but it does not interest me. You need not envy me the bright sky, for it gives me no pleasure. There is so much to pain and sadden so much that makes me angry. On Sunday I was miserable. The Spences are as kind as any one could be, but you understand me.
